The American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, 4th Edition
  • n. A place where something is deposited, as for storage or safekeeping; a repository.
  • n. A trustee; a depositary.

  • The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ia
  • n. A place where anything is lodged for safe keeping: as, a warehouse is a depository for goods.
  • n. [Prop. depositary.] A person to whom a thing is intrusted for safe-keeping; a depositary.
